#65aca4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#65aca4 is composed of 39.6% red, 67.5% green and 64.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 4.7% yellow and 32.5% black. It has a hue angle of 173.2 degrees, a saturation of 30% and a lightness of 53.5%. #65aca4 color hex could be obtained by blending #caffff with #005949.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

Shades and Tints of #65aca4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060c0b is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#65aca4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#80918f is the less saturated color, while #13fee4 is the most saturated one.
